Description

Up for grabs is this quaint bungalow on Second Avenue in the Regional Street area of Port aux Basques. This two-bedroom has a bonus room in the attic space which offers a great storage area or can double as an office space or craft room. The open kitchen/living room/ dining room area has had recent upgrades, including California-style ceilings and has a cozy woodstove, which was professionally installed and WETT certified in 2021, keeping heating costs under wraps in the coldest months. The exterior had extensive renovations in 2021 including all new vinyl siding, doors and windows. The four-piece bath has a jacuzzi tub and separate stand-up shower. A single garage at the back of the property provides the additional space you may need for tools, supplies and bigger machines. This is a great starter or downsizer and offers all-one-level living.
